In the state of Ohio can a creditor garnish your bank account if you are late with a payment?

Yes, in Ohio, a creditor can garnish your bank account if you are late with a payment, but they must first obtain a court judgment against you. Once they have the judgment, they can file a garnishment action to withdraw funds directly from your bank account. However, certain exemptions may apply, protecting a portion of your funds, particularly those from sources like Social Security or disability payments.

Can treasury dept offset ssi disability payments?

The Treasury Department can offset SSI disability payments to cover an over-payment or other debt. An offset notice is mailed to the individual, which provides an individual an opportunity to appeal the offset before it occurs.

Do you have to show va payment on tax forms?

VA compensation payments for service connected disability is NOT reported as taxable income on your income tax return.

What is stipulation agreement in eviction case?

A stipulation in an eviction is a agreement where the landlord and tenant agree to something, such as a move-out date, payment of rent for dismissal of the eviction, etc.
